From adf58ddc0337678c2a6770fe8687e54a44998c0d Mon Sep 17 00:00:00 2001
From: kongdeqiang <123456>
Date: 星期三, 02 四月 2025 15:43:12 +0800
Subject: [PATCH] Merge remote-tracking branch 'origin/master'
---
platformx-device-biz/src/main/resources/mapper/DeviceRepairMapper.xml | 24 +++++++++++++++++++++++-
1 files changed, 23 insertions(+), 1 deletions(-)
diff --git a/platformx-device-biz/src/main/resources/mapper/DeviceRepairMapper.xml b/platformx-device-biz/src/main/resources/mapper/DeviceRepairMapper.xml
index f85d139..460e9fa 100644
--- a/platformx-device-biz/src/main/resources/mapper/DeviceRepairMapper.xml
+++ b/platformx-device-biz/src/main/resources/mapper/DeviceRepairMapper.xml
@@ -6,7 +6,7 @@
<resultMap id="deviceRepairMap" type="com.by4cloud.platformx.device.entity.DeviceScrap">
<id property="id" column="id"/>
<result property="compId" column="comp_id"/>
- <result property="deviceCoder" column="device_coder"/>
+ <result property="deviceCode" column="device_code"/>
<result property="deviceId" column="device_id"/>
<result property="inventoryId" column="inventory_id"/>
<result property="repairEndDate" column="repair_end_date"/>
@@ -19,4 +19,26 @@
<result property="updateTime" column="update_time"/>
<result property="delFlag" column="del_flag"/>
</resultMap>
+ <select id="pageNew" resultType="com.by4cloud.platformx.device.entity.vo.DeviceRepairPageVo">
+ select
+ dr.id,
+ d.name deviceName,
+ d.`number` deviceCode,
+ dr.serial_no,
+ dr.repair_start_date,
+ dr.repair_end_date,
+ dr.status
+ from
+ device_repair dr
+ join device d on
+ dr.device_id = d.id
+ where
+ dr.del_flag='0'
+ <if test="queryDTO.deviceName != null and queryDTO.deviceName !=''">
+ and d.name like CONCAT('%', #{queryDTO.deviceName}, '%')
+ </if>
+ <if test="queryDTO.serialNo != null and queryDTO.serialNo !=''">
+ and dr.serial_no like CONCAT('%', #{queryDTO.serialNo}, '%')
+ </if>
+ </select>
</mapper>
\ No newline at end of file
--
Gitblit v1.9.1